My wife and I were new to town and wanted to try a new Mexican restaurant. The food was ok but nothing to write home about since the cheese in my wifes cheese quesadilla wasn't even melted. What really warrants the score though is that when the bill came, our waitress just came with a mobile card reader and told us how much the bill was, no itemized ticket or breakdown was given. Since it was in line with what I expected, I gave her my card and she ran the payment. She asked if I needed a receipt to which I replied no since I typically leave my copy on the table anyhow. However when she gave me my card back she just walked away and didn't give me anything to sign. I didn't have cash so didn't know how to leave a tip since I couldn't add it to the bill. Nor did she ask if I wanted to put the tip on the card before she ran it. We sat for a couple of minutes because we didn't know what to do but she never paid us any more notice. I hated to do it, but we left without leaving a tip as we had no way to do so. When it finally hit my bank account, I noticed that $5 had been added to my $26.xx total. While this is likely what I would have left, the fact that it was automatically added and that I was never given a chance or choice to do so is what's aggregating. I can't say I'll never be back but it will be a long long time...

On our trip across the country we have tried many Mexican restaurants, Los Tres Magueyes was one of the best. It was a pleasant surprise to find this gem in Fuquay-Varina. Service was fast and friendly. The food it’s self was fabulous. I ordered the chori-pollo and it was so good, and complete with a house made hot sauce that was packing some definite heat. The atmosphere is a bit bright and tacky but in no way takes away from the experience. I will plan to visit every time that I find myself in this part of the country.

First time eating at this location. It was taco Tuesday so ordered 2 hard and 2 soft tacos. They were discounted but cant remember the price. Somewhere around $2 each. Also had the cheese dip with our chips. Everything was good/average/typical mexican restaurant food. We were one of only 2 or 3 tables seated around 530pm. Service was good. Beer special on Tuesday included Dos Equis drafts for 1.99. Other drafts (domestic) were under 1.50. Overall I like this place and will come back.
